How to Pair Earbuds to Your TV
The process of pairing earbuds to your TV varies depending on the type of TV and earbuds you have. Here are some general steps:
For Bluetooth TVs
If your TV has Bluetooth capabilities, you can pair your earbuds directly to the TV. Here’s how:
- Put your earbuds in pairing mode: This usually involves holding down a button on the earbuds until they flash or display a pairing message.
- Go to your TV’s Bluetooth settings: This is usually found in the TV’s settings menu under “Sound” or “Audio.”
- Select your earbuds from the list of available devices: Your TV should detect your earbuds and display them in a list of available devices.
- Confirm the pairing: Once you’ve selected your earbuds, confirm the pairing on your TV and earbuds.
For Non-Bluetooth TVs
If your TV doesn’t have Bluetooth capabilities, you can use a separate device to pair your earbuds to your TV. Here are a few options:
- Bluetooth transmitter: A Bluetooth transmitter is a small device that connects to your TV’s audio output and transmits the audio signal to your earbuds.
- Soundbar with Bluetooth: If you have a soundbar with Bluetooth capabilities, you can pair your earbuds to the soundbar, which will then transmit the audio signal to your earbuds.
- Streaming devices: Some streaming devices, such as Roku or Chromecast, allow you to pair earbuds directly to the device.

Things to Consider When Pairing Earbuds to Your TV
When pairing earbuds to your TV, there are a few things to consider, including:
- Latency: Latency refers to the delay between the audio signal and the video. Some earbuds may experience latency, which can be distracting.
- Audio quality: The audio quality of your earbuds can greatly impact your viewing experience. Look for earbuds with high-quality audio and advanced noise-cancellation features.
- Comfort: If you plan to watch TV for extended periods, look for earbuds that are comfortable and won’t cause fatigue.

Do I need a special adapter to pair my earbuds to my TV?
You may need a special adapter to pair your earbuds to your TV, depending on the type of technology your TV uses. For example, if your TV only has an optical audio output, you may need an adapter to convert the signal to Bluetooth or another type of wireless technology that your earbuds can use.
There are many different types of adapters available, so you’ll need to choose one that is compatible with both your TV and your earbuds. Some adapters are specifically designed to work with certain brands or models of TVs or earbuds, so be sure to check the specifications before making a purchase. In some cases, you may also be able to use a universal adapter that can work with a variety of different devices.
Can I pair my earbuds to multiple devices at the same time?
Some earbuds can be paired to multiple devices at the same time, while others can only be paired to one device at a time. If you want to be able to switch between different devices, such as your TV and your phone, you’ll need to look for earbuds that support multi-device pairing.
Even if your earbuds do support multi-device pairing, you may still need to manually switch between devices. For example, you may need to go to the settings menu on your TV and select your earbuds as the active device, and then do the same thing on your phone. Some earbuds may also have a feature that allows them to automatically switch between devices based on which one is actively playing audio.
Will pairing my earbuds to my TV affect the audio quality?
Pairing your earbuds to your TV can potentially affect the audio quality, depending on the type of technology used and the quality of the earbuds themselves. For example, if your TV uses Bluetooth to connect to your earbuds, you may experience some compression or latency, which can affect the sound quality.
However, many modern TVs and earbuds use advanced technologies that can help to minimize these effects. For example, some TVs and earbuds use aptX or other audio codecs that are designed to provide high-quality audio over Bluetooth. In general, the quality of the audio will depend on the specific devices you are using, so it’s a good idea to read reviews and do some research before making a purchase.
